Kim Kardashian and Kris Humphries Renew Their Vows

On television, of course.

Professing their, um, love in front of millions of viewers once wasn’t enough for newlyweds Kim Kardashian and Kris Humphries. On Wednesday, they did it again. This time, the made-for-reality couple re-did their I Do’s on the Ellen DeGeneres Show.

 

"We are gathered here today because we are the only 300 people who weren't invited to Kim's and Kris's wedding," DeGeneres joked. "And now, in this mecca of daytime television, we reaffirm the bond of marriage between Kris Humphries and Kris Kardashian — all rights reserved, E! Television Productions."

 

"It's been five weeks since your wedding, which is a long time for reality TV stars, so it's time to renew your vows," she said before giving Humphries's an unorthodox set of vows included promising to "honor, love and keep up" with his wife, and to buy a copy of DeGeneres's new book, Seriously, I'm Kidding.

 

Kardashian was ordered to promise to put Humphries first, or "at least above Kourtney but below Khloe."

 

After the two exchanged rings, DeGeneres — with the "authority given to me by Ryan Seacrest" — pronounced the couple man and wife.

 

Rumor has it that Seacrest’s producers have already booked Judge Judy for the divorce proceedings.
